Young Farmer Councils

(N.Z. Presi Association) new plymoutil June 17: The Young Farmers’ Club movement in New Zealand has been divided into six councils. The annual meeting of the New Zealand federation at New Plymouth today approved the formation of a sixth council, by dividing the existing Wellington council into two new councils.

The Wellington council previously covered the southern half of thh North Island. This area will be split approximately in half. It has not yet been decided What the new council will be called.
